Q. What is dry-land agriculture? Discuss its importance in India? (42 BPSC/1999) Ans: Dryland farming is agricultural techniques for the non-irrigated cultivation of crops. Drylands are areas with low soil moisture, high evapotranspiration which results in water deficit prevailing throughout the year. These areas are prone to drought and have scarce water-resources.
